Roasted Strawberry Whipped Ricotta Toast Recipe

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 20 minutes
  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: 2 servings

Ingredients

Scale

Strawberries and Topping

  • 1 pound strawberries, ends removed
  • 2 tablespoons honey
  • Juice of 1/2 lemon
  • 4 sprigs fresh thyme, plus extra for garnish

Bread and Ricotta

  • 2 slices rustic bread, 1-inch thick
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 3/4 cup whole milk ricotta cheese
  • Pinch of sea salt


Instructions

  1. Roast the Strawberries: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Place the cleaned strawberries in a medium baking dish. Drizzle them evenly with honey, then squeeze the juice of half a lemon over the berries. Scatter the fresh thyme sprigs on top. Roast the strawberries for 20 minutes, stirring halfway through, until they become soft and syrupy. Once done, set them aside to cool slightly.
  2. Toast the Bread: While the strawberries roast, drizzle the rustic bread slices with olive oil on both sides. Place the bread slices directly in the oven and toast them for about 1 minute until they are lightly golden and crisp. Watch carefully to avoid burning.
  3. Whip the Ricotta: Transfer the ricotta cheese to a food processor. Pulse the ricotta for 30 seconds to 1 minute, scraping down the sides as needed, until it becomes light, fluffy, and smooth in texture.
  4. Assemble the Toast: Spread the whipped ricotta evenly over the toasted rustic bread slices. Spoon the roasted strawberries along with their syrupy juices on top of the ricotta. Garnish with additional fresh thyme leaves and lightly sprinkle a pinch of sea salt over each toast. Serve immediately to enjoy the vibrant flavors and textures.

Notes

  • For a dairy-free option, substitute ricotta with a plant-based soft cheese or whipped tofu.
  • Adjust the honey amount based on the sweetness of your strawberries.
  • Use fresh thyme or try other herbs like basil or mint for variation.
  • Serve as a brunch dish or a light dessert.
  • Make sure to toast the bread just enough to hold the toppings without becoming soggy.
